Dental implants restore your jawline

A permanent replacement of the teeth can restore your jawline. This is the backing your mouth requires to stay functionally on point. A dental implant is a real tooth replacement option consisting of biocompatible titanium. The titanium implant is positioned in the mouth, and it is highly unlikely that the jaw will reject it. The jaw then develops around this dental implant to provide adequate support for the replacement tooth. 

Dental implants prevent teeth from twisting

Awful gaps in the mouth after losing one or more teeth can give rise to unwanted oral health oral health issues. In certain instances, the teeth around the gaps will curl to hide the gap that the missing teeth create. When you have crooked teeth, it’s difficult to have a confident smile!
